Output 2f3c68fd77c63afe2974c7b84c19a6c043ac71eb5aa45c19283ceb17cb357b93:0

value
2454152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ecfa6e2ee9a9ab5901ee1163737b11dced87ac19 OP_EQUAL
address
3PJ3Q2R2xzXjR7AKTXyT2jniGJAPs2BLHp
transaction
2f3c68fd77c63afe2974c7b84c19a6c043ac71eb5aa45c19283ceb17cb357b93
confirmations
317692
spent
true